‘Absolute mustard’: Some Everton fans wowed by £90k-a-week ace in FA Cup third-round win
A number of Everton fans have taken to Twitter to praise James Rodriguez’s match-winning display in the Toffees’ FA Cup third-round win today.
Carlo Ancelotti’s charges took on Rotherham at Goodison Park but were made to work hard for their victory, eventually triumphing in extra time.
Cenk Tosun opened the scoring for Everton after just nine minutes, the Turkey international’s clever chipped finish giving him his first goal in blue since 2019.

However, the Millers regrouped and took the game to the Toffees, with the likes of Matthew Olosunde, Daniel Barlaser and Matt Crooks all coming close.
Rotherham went on to level in the 56th minute as Olosunde hooked home a finish into the far corner of Robin Olsen’s net from a tight angle.
Tosun was denied a second goal by VAR in the latter stages of normal time, but substitute Abdoulaye Doucoure slotted home the winner early on in extra time.
Admittedly, James did not deliver the best performance, fading as the game went on, but all he needed was one opportunity and he took it with a superb through-ball to Doucoure.
